Orchid Conservation
Malagasy orchids can be propagated in nurseries using
simple and cheap technology. Money raised by the Threatened Plants
of Madagascar Appeal is helping us work with our colleagues at the
botanic garden at Tsimbazaza, to set up a nursery and develop appropriate
propagation methods for endangered orchids. Plants will be provided
for educational displays and for future reintroduction programmes,
and we will also help train local conservationists.
